A Wickedly Adorable Minnie Mouse Pumpkin

Get ready for Halloween with this adorable Minnie Mouse witch themed pumpkin from DisneyFamily. This craft inspired by the beautiful Minnie Mouse is both spooky and sweet.

What You’ll Need

  • Pumpkin
  • Black and white paint
  • Black craft foam
  • Pink stiff felt sheet
  • Orange satin fabric
  • Hot glue
  • Scissors

  1. Sketch and cut out Minnie’s facial features from black craft foam. Use the printable PDF as a guide to cut out Minnie’s ears.

2. Paint the pumpkin white, and then add a layer of black paint, leaving the shape of Minnie’s face.

3. To make Minnie’s hat, cut out a large circle of pink felt for the brim. On this piece, you’ll need to cut a small hole in the center, so the pumpkin stem will fit through. Cut out a second pink felt circle that is the same size as the first. Cut to remove about 1/3 of the circle, as if you’ve taken 1/3 of a pie away.

4. Roll up this piece and glue together to make the pointy top of Minnie’s hat. Glue to the brim piece (circle #1 from step 3 above).

5. To make Minnie’s bow, cut out a long and wide rectangular piece of orange fabric. (You may also use ribbon.) Fold each end to meet in the middle and add a drop of glue to keep in place.

6. Cut out a smaller rectangular piece of orange fabric and wrap it around the center of the first piece. Hot glue the ends together at the back to secure. Wrap another piece of fabric around the bottom of the pointy hat and glue in place.

7. Place the hat on the pumpkin. Next, add Minnie’s ear. You’ll need to cut a slit in each ear in order to slide them over the hat. Hot glue in place.

8. Hot glue Minnie’s facial features onto the pumpkin, and finally her bow!

Your spooky and sweet Minnie Mouse pumpkin is now ready to greet your guests for Halloween.
